Output 2854854b7ec9ccbe0dd791e7fe66a877e351a73605875516b8776680b03df33a:1

value
529115490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81da2c392e66b0c3b6a0b25edf537bdff0d1070 OP_EQUAL
address
3MPjP7Ma2h58xJWRVLjU2VWzuFDz2dWgfx
transaction
2854854b7ec9ccbe0dd791e7fe66a877e351a73605875516b8776680b03df33a
spent
true